About the Role:
We’re looking for a polished, adaptable Patient Care Coordinator join our team. If you thrive in a luxury environment, are proactive, and have a knack for both service and sales, we want to meet you.
As our Patient Care Coordinator, you’ll be the first point of contact for our patients, playing a key role in shaping their experience from their initial call through post-procedure care.
What You’ll Do:
- Welcome patients warmly and deliver a luxury-level experience
- Manage patient appointments and communications with precision and care
- Educate patients on procedures and financing options, with a consultative, sales-savvy approach
- Maintain accurate patient records, ensuring confidentiality and full HIPAA compliance
- Work independently, anticipating and solving problems before they arise
- Coordinate every detail of patient care, demonstrating keen attention to detail and follow-through
- Support the team with administrative tasks, including scheduling, billing, and office organization
- Bring positive, team-oriented energy to every interaction and help foster a harmonious office environment
Who You Are:
- You have at least 2 years of experience as a patient care coordinator in a plastic surgery or dermatology office –MANDATORY, candidates without this experience will not be considered.
- Tech-savvy, you pick up new software and systems quickly – this is a must
- Experienced in high-end healthcare or plastic surgery, with a deep appreciation for luxury-level service
- Genuinely personable, with excellent interpersonal skills and a positive mindset
- Adaptable, resourceful, and comfortable juggling multiple priorities
- Exceptionally organized, with great attention to detail
- A self-starter who works well with minimal oversight and meets high expectations
- Knowledgeable about cosmetic or aesthetic procedures
- Proficient with electronic medical records (EMR) and scheduling software
